Default Turbo Q's

i got a greddy turbo kit for my 99 civic sir and i've got it mostly installed except for the piping now my intercooler isn't gonna be here for another 2 weeks would it be safe enough to drive it without the intercooler for 2 weeks or no? i know i should have it but it won't be boosting above 5 psi until the intercooler arrives.

another question is what is the easier way to increase the boost on my kit once my intercooler arrives? i've got greddy e-manage also incase that helps. would i just get a boost controller or is there another way? also if i increase the boost from 5 psi to 7 or 8 psi will i need to get greddy e-mange re-tuned?

Default Re: Turbo Q's (tsdneil)

Yes if your tuned at 5 psi and than you raise it to 8 things arent gonna work out to well for you. Slap on your boost controller before you get it tuned and get it tuned on 5 and 8 psi think of it as a high and low boost setting. That way you can cruse around at 5 and also turn it up to 8 when you want and you'll be safe.
